From left: Brenda Edelman, older adults director at Jewish Family and Children’s Service of Greater Philadelphia; Inna Gulko, director of support services at KleinLife; Andre Krug, president and CEO of KleinLife; Rabbi Sandra Rosenthal Berliner, spiritual leader, of KleinLife; Andrea Kimelheim, active adult life program director at KleinLife; and attendees Andrea Green and Helena Swerdlik.

KleinLife, 10100 Jamison Ave., recently held a Rosh Hashanah observance to mark the Jewish New Year.

Some 200 seniors from throughout the Northeast and surrounding communities attended the celebration, which included prayer and ethnic foods. ••
